Differentiating VoIP and Non-VoIP Numbers

In today's rapidly evolving world of communication, it's crucial to understand the distinctions between various telephony technologies. Two prominent forms of phone numbers are VoIP (Voice over Internet Protocol) and traditional non-VoIP numbers. VoIP utilizes the internet to transmit voice information, offering advantages such as cost-effectiveness and flexibility. Conversely, non-VoIP networks rely on dedicated phone lines, providing a more traditional communication approach.

  • Opting for the appropriate type of number depends on individual needs and circumstances.
  • VoIP connections are perfect for businesses or individuals seeking affordability solutions, while non-VoIP connections may be more suitable for those requiring a consistent connection with high sound.

In essence, understanding the variations between VoIP and non-VoIP numbers empowers you to make an informed decision that aligns with your communication expectations.
